PluginFacadeStartHostInfoSetHostActivity - метод
Задаёт метод, который должен осуществлять некоторые действия, по окончании которых хост завершает свою работу.
Пространство имён: Chronos.Platform.SchedulingСборка: Chronos.Platform (в Chronos.Platform.dll) Версия: 3.6.0.22
public PluginFacadeStartHostInfo SetHostActivity(
Func<CancellationToken, Task> hostActivityActionAsync
)
Public Function SetHostActivity (
hostActivityActionAsync As Func(Of CancellationToken, Task)
) As PluginFacadeStartHostInfo
public:
PluginFacadeStartHostInfo^ SetHostActivity(
Func<CancellationToken, Task^>^ hostActivityActionAsync
)
member SetHostActivity :
hostActivityActionAsync : Func<CancellationToken, Task> -> PluginFacadeStartHostInfo
- hostActivityActionAsync FuncCancellationToken, Task
-
Метод, который должен осуществлять некоторые действия, по окончании которых хост завершает свою работу.
Если параметр равен null, то в качестве такого метода используется вызов
await Task.Delay(Timeout.Infinite, cancellationToken).
Исключение OperationCanceledException, выбрасываемое этим методом, игнорируется,
поэтому его можно не перехватывать внутри метода при ожидании токена.
PluginFacadeStartHostInfoТекущий объект.